The Diagnostic Refine: Identifying Cataracts
When it concerns diagnosing cataracts, clarity is vital. You'll start with a detailed eye examination, where you'll examine visual acuity and check for any kind of signs of cloudiness in the lens.
Throughout this process, you'll use customized equipment, such as a slit lamp, to obtain an in-depth view of the eye's structure. You'll additionally do a dilated eye examination to review the lens and retina better.
Collecting your patient's case history is essential, as it aids determine risk variables like age, diabetes, or previous eye injuries.
After examining the results, you'll figure out the existence and seriousness of cataracts. This careful technique ensures you offer the best referrals for therapy, establishing the stage for the next action in their treatment.

Post-Operative Treatment: Making Sure Optimal Recuperation
Once the surgical treatment is total, your duty changes to ensuring the person's smooth recovery.
You'll start by supplying clear post-operative instructions, worrying the value of wearing the eye shield and taking prescribed drugs. Advise them to stay clear of massaging their eyes and participating in exhausting activities.
